Bruntwood Pall Mall

Pall Mall is Manchester's newest sustainable hub for work and wellbeing, a Grade II listed building in the heart of King Street offering serviced, leased and furnished offices. Net zero across its communal spaces, it combines heritage with cutting edge sustainability and premium amenities: a high spec gym, wellness studio and contemplation room, a panoramic roof terrace and event space, an on-site cafe, an outdoor piazza and collaborative lounges. A cycle hub with repair station, showers, changing, drying and ironing facilities support active commuters. It suits startups, scale-ups and established businesses across technology, finance and professional services, a short walk from Manchester Victoria and the Exchange Square tram stop.

Frequently asked questions about Pall Mall

The address is Pall Mall, 1 Pollen Square, 59 King Street, Manchester, M2 4PD, in the heart of the city centre.

Reception is staffed Monday to Friday, 08:00 to 17:00.

Available offices range from around 124 to 2,991 sq ft (roughly 2 to 30 people), across serviced, leased and furnished options.

A high spec gym, wellness studio and contemplation room, a panoramic roof terrace and event space, an on-site cafe and outdoor piazza, collaborative lounges with kitchen, pitch, presentation and meeting rooms, and a cycle hub with repair station, showers, changing, drying and ironing rooms. Communal spaces are net zero.

It is a short walk from the Exchange Square tram stop and Manchester Victoria station, in a prime central location on King Street.
